Traffic: catalog numbers and photometric attributes
The two search behaviors that matter here look nothing alike. One is a catalog number typed exactly as it appears on a specification sheet, where the buyer wants confirmation and stock and nothing else. The other is an attribute search built from photometric and control requirements: a wattage, a color temperature, a lumen range, a dimming protocol, an application such as high bay or wall pack. A category tree that stops at lighting and devices serves neither. The work is a page for every catalog number carrying the full specification as text, plus application and attribute collections generated from product data so a search for a specific output and control type lands somewhere useful.
